quote: Originally posted by uncle Google:
bouncy freeform - ams confused!
Think of a more energectic & uplifting type of Freeform with hard kicks, not always much in the vocals & not really cheesy but with a euphoric edge to it! The term isn't used to often but as suggested, listen to Sharkey's mixes on bonkers 15 & 16 to here some more bouncy tunes! Other types of Freeform can be more dark & underground, Bouncy Freeform is uplifting but still harder than mainstream Hardcore!
